What Markus means

Where Markus comes from and what it has meant to the people who carry it.

Markus descends from the Latin Marcus, among the oldest names carried by Roman citizens. The Romans linked it to Mars, their god of war, so the short meaning reads as dedicated to Mars, warlike. That martial sense sat inside the name from early on, though it said nothing certain about any boy who bore it.

From Latin the name traveled north. German and Scandinavian families adopted Markus and kept the spelling with its hard k, and it became a familiar entry on many a Norwegian or German class register. In Poland the same root gives Marek, the variant most children hear at school.

A boy named Markus shares his name with Mark the Evangelist, whose symbol is the winged lion. Warlike in origin, the name has grown mild in daily use.

Say it at an urząd counter and the clerk writes it without asking twice. The war god is still there in that first hard syllable, but few pause on Mars now. What stays plain is the root: Marcus, and its Polish cousin Marek.

How many people are named Markus

1 in 16233 men in Poland is named Markus. 1,315 people carry it in the 2025 register: rank #845 among male names.

Where Markus is most popular

Markus is most popular in Opole, 460% above the national average (8 boys born 2019–2025), followed by West Pomeranian (+244%) and Lower Silesian (+126%). It is least common in Pomeranian and Łódź, 56% and 49% below average respectively.

Markus as a middle name

Markus is a first name for 1,315 men in Poland and a middle name for another 396, a 77/23 split. In the men's middle-name ranking it sits 353rd, between Zbyszek (399) and Kurt (393).
